Two species of toxic lilies were in the top five common exposures in 2020: true lilies (Lilium species) and daylilies (Hemerocallis species), which can both cause kidney failure in cats. Ingesting just small pieces of the petals, leaves, or even the pollen or water in the vase can result in severe, potentially irreversible and fatal kidney failure. Your cat will be administered medications via the IV route to help reduce nausea and fluids to help promote kidney function. In the later stages of kidney toxicity, approximately 24 hours after ingestion, if your cat stops urinating, this carries a very poor prognosis of survival. These fluids should be given for a minimum of 48-72 hours while monitoring the amount of urine they are producing, which might require your cat to have a urinary catheter in place. As the fluids pass through the urinary system, they go through the kidneys first and carry the present toxins with them to be eliminated in the urinary waste. While the exact toxin has not been identified, exposure to any part of the plant can cause sudden kidney failure and even neurological signs in cats. As the toxin begins to affect the kidneys, these signs continue and worsen as the kidney damage progresses. If your cat survives a lily ingestion, they will need to have regular checkups and bloodwork after they are hospitalized to ensure that the kidneys are recovering. Other lilies, like Calla and Peace lilies, dont cause fatal kidney failure, but they can irritate your cats mouth and esophagus (the tube that connects the mouth to the stomach).
